Hur man skriver standardkod i C ++
Det finns oändliga metoder för att programmera en dator. Den sista personen som har ett uttalande om hur man implementerar det program han behöver är programmeraren själv. Det finns dock vissa "standarder" för programmering relaterade till olika stilar eller tankegångar, hur man använder funktionerna och hur man skriver koden för att optimera kompileringen för att få ett slutligt program mer effektivt och säkert. Det är nödvändigt att sätta igång några knep när du skriver kod för ett program, för att vara säker på att i framtiden vem måste göra ändringar eller helt enkelt utföra underhållet (du kan vara för) kunna läsa och förstå programmet utan problem.
steg
g ++ main.cpp
./a.out
Provkod
Exempel nummer 1:
/ * Detta är ett enkelt program för att förstå grunderna för g ++ programmeringsstil. Detta program sammanställs med g ++-kompilatorn. * / #include/ * inkluderar användning av inmatnings- och utgångsfunktioner * / använder namnskylten std- / * vi använder funktionerna `std` (standard) * / int main () / * deklaration av huvudfunktionen `main`. Det kan också deklareras som int main (void) * / {cout << "Hej pappa" - / * ` n` skapar en ny rad istället ` t` lägger till en flik * / cout << "Hej mamma" -cout << " n Detta är mitt första program" -cout << " n Datum 09/11/2014" -return 0-}
Exempel nummer 2:
/ * Detta program beräknar summan av två siffror * / # inkluderaAnvända namespace std-int main () {float num1, num2, res- / * programmet fungerar också genom att deklarera variabler som int, dubbel, lång ... * / cout << " n Ange det första numret = " -cin num1- / * Jag lagrar användarinmatningen i variabeln num1 * / cout << " n Ange det andra numret = " -cin num2-res = num1 + num2-cout << " n Summan av "<< num1 <<" och "<< num2 <<" = "<
Exempel nummer 3:
/ * Beräkning av produkten mellan två nummer * / # ingårAnvänd namnspace std-int main () {float num1-int num2-double res-cout << " n Ange det första numret = " -cin num1-cout << " n Ange det andra numret = " -cin num2-res = num1 * num2-cout << " n Produkten av de två siffrorna är = " << res ` n` -return 0-}
Exempel nummer 4:
// Jag kör en cykel för att hitta den matematiska ekvationen. I det här fallet identifierar vi svaret // till projektets första frågausing namespace std-int main () {// startar programmaint koden sum1 = int sum2 = 0- 0- 0- int = int sum3 sum4 = 0- // deklarera int variabler att beräkna risultato.for (int a = 0- till < 1000- a = a + 3) = {sum1 sum1 + a-} // Exekvera en 1000 iterationer kontinuerlig cykel i vilken för att lägga till upp till 3 `A`- vid slutet av den höga` sum1 `och` a`.for (int b = 0- b < 1000- b = b + 5) = {sum2 sum2 + b-} // jag köra en 1000 iteration cykel i vilken jag att fortsätta att lägga till upp till 5 `b`- efter hög` sum2 `och` b`.for (int c = 0- c < 1000- c = c + 15) = {sum3 sum3 c- +} // jag köra en 1000 iteration cykel i vilken jag att fortsätta att lägga till upp till 15 `hög i slutet där-` sum3 `och` c`.sum4 = sum1 + sum2 - sum3- // Jag tilldelar summa 4 resultatet av summan av summa 1 och summa minus sum3.cout << sum4- // Jag genererar utgången med sum4.cin.get () - // Jag väntar på användaren att trycka på enter key.return 0- // Return statement.} // Avsluta koden
Några exempel på programmeringsstilar:
int main () {int i = 0-if (1 + 1 == 2) {i = 2 -}} / * Detta är Whitesmiths-stilen * / int main () {int i-if (1 + 1 == 2) {i = 2 -}} / * Detta är GNU style * / int main () {int i-if (villkor) {i = 2-funktion () -}}
tips
- För att kompilera dina program, använd alltid en ISO-kompilator.
- `a.out` är standardnamnet som tilldelats av kompilatorn till den exekverbara filen som genererats från källkoden.
varningar
- Använd aldrig en förvirrande stil eller avlägsna funktioner.
- Så här öppnar du MSG-filer
- Hur beräkna summan av två siffror i Java
- Hur börjar man lära sig programmering
- Hur man sammanställer och kör ett Java-program med hjälp av kommandotolkningen
- Hur man sammanställer ett C-program med GNU GCC-kompilatorn
- Hur man sammanställer ett program i Linux
- Hur man spricker en programvara med CrackedDLL
- Hur man skapar program på en Ti 83 Graphic Calculator
- Så här skapar och redigerar du textfiler på Linux med terminalen
- Så här skapar du ditt första Java-program i Ubuntu Linux
- Så här avinstallerar du ett program från Windows 8
- Hur man skapar ett program med anteckningsblock
- Hur man skapar ett program i C
- Så här avinstallerar du ett program i Windows
- Hur man kör ett program med hög prioritet i Windows
- Hur man lär sig att programmera i C Använda Turbo C ++ IDE
- Komma igång Programmering i Python
- Så här installerar du Windows-program i Ubuntu
- Så här installerar du Java Development Kit (JDK) på Mac OS X
- Hur man hämtar, installerar och kör JDK och Eclipse
- Hur man skriver det klassiska Hello World-programmet i Python